Helen White, in religion Helen.
Born: 1694 in Ross, Ireland.
Died: aft 1748.

father: Henry White
mother: Dame Jane Catherine Shea

Benedictines, Ghent choir nun.
She was clothed Apr 1710, aged 16.

She professed Aug 1711, aged 17/ 18.

Portress

Sources: Ghent Annals list: 199; Ghent Annals: 54; RAG B133: 5v; RAG K2296: 25r.
